Make Multiaddr::iter
borrow data (#478)
* Use `unsigned-varint` crate. * Implement `Display` for `Protocol`. Gives `ToString` for free. * Use `Cow` in `AddrComponent`. * Add `AddrComponent::acquire`. * Document `AddrComponent::acquire`.
